Be Ready to Help Your Crohn's Disease Patients Start Biologics
You'll see biologics considered earlier for Crohn's disease...partly due to new guidelines from the Am College of Gastroenterology.
This "top-down" approach is becoming more popular...versus waiting to see if meds such as sulfasalazine, mesalamine, or corticosteroids help.
For Crohn's, anticipate seeing infliximab (Remicade), adalimumab (Humira), certolizumab (Cimzia), vedolizumab (Entyvio), etc. These can lead to faster and longer-lasting remission for some higher-risk patients.
